MySQL数据库windows安装
下载
下载地址:https://dev.mysql.com/downloads/mysql/
可以选择下载MSI版本,点击直接安装,或者zip版本解压安装,我这里选择64位zip版本
将其解压到安装目录,我这里将它解压到D:\mysql-8.0.11-winx64。
配置环境变量
新建变量名:MYSQL_PATH
变量值:D:\mysql-8.0.11-winx64(根据自己的安装目录)
Path里加入%MYSQL_HOME%\bin;
生成data文件
以管理员身份运行cmd,进入到D:\mysql-8.0.11-winx64\bin
(我下载的解压出没有my.ini,所以没有像网上所说的那样设置,按照下面方式也正确运行了,如果有my.ini应该在这插一步,执行命令 mysqld -install mysql --default-file= my.ini的物理路径 (这句命令是添加mysql服务,并把my.ini设为配置文件))
执行命令:mysqld --initialize-insecure --user=mysql 这句命令是为了初始化数据库data
安装服务
执行 mysqld install,如果以前安装过,这里显示已经安装,可以退到上级目录,执行mysqld –remove,然后cd到bin再安装,不然对启动服务可能有影响
启动
net start mysql启动服务
因为配置过环境变量,所以直接运行cmd后执行mysql -u root –p就可以进入登陆(无密码)
改密码
查询用户密码命令:mysql> select host,user,authentication_string from mysql.user;发现8.0版本后和以前的结果不同,所以改密码的sql语句发生变化
show databases;
use mysql;
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Y ''123456”;
本文整理自网络,方便自己,方便他人。